In Sumy, Occupiers Hit a Geriatric Boarding House with a Bomb: There Are Injured.


Russian invaders shelled the city of Sumy with guided aerial bombs. One of the enemy's targets was a geriatric boarding house where 221 elderly people lived. Evacuation is currently underway.
According to the head of the Sumy Regional Military Administration, Volodymyr Artyukh, there are injured people, some of whom are in a serious condition, and they have been taken to the hospital. Fortunately, there are no casualties among the residents of the boarding house.
It should be recalled that on the night of September 19, Russian occupiers shelled the city of Kharkiv, resulting in the destruction of two houses and a fire that spread to household structures and vegetation.
It is known that the Russian invaders used ballistic weapons for this attack. The Kharkiv Regional Prosecutor's Office has already started an investigation into the violation of laws and customs of war.
